This has only happened because pidsley mentioned it. euclid-wm, with its source in the ~/git directory, heavily unbloated down to an install size of exactly 1GB

What's new? I ripped DebianJoe's "kxt" toolkit, a very neat little helper tool. Thank you Joe, I love it!

What else? Not much to say here, this is Shark Fin with euclid-wm, kernel is 3.12-8, sysV as init daemon, and extremely low dependency count but full functionality.
